The Portable Document Format or PDF is a widely used document format for a variety of reasons. PDFs are accessible from any device, so you can share them between gadgets with different displays and settings. PDF documents will always appear the same, regardless of whether you open them on an Apple computer, a Microsoft one or use a smartphone.

Data security is another reason we rather use PDF files for storing and sharing personal data and documents. Besides password protection features, some platforms offer opening history to track down those who opened or filled out the document.

To change your name on your driver's license or state ID card, you must visit a branch office and present: Your valid driver's license or state ID card. Proof of the name change. You'll need to bring in a certified name-change document, such as your marriage license or court order.
Your receipt from the Social Security office (just in case!) or your new Social Security card if you already have it. Your current driver's license. Proof of address, if required in your state.
Proof of Citizenship: your valid passport or a certified copy of your birth certificate. Proof of Name Change: a certified copy of your marriage license. ... Proof of Identity: this must show your name, date of birth or age, and have a recent photograph. ... Your current Social Security card.
Bring your current REAL ID driver license, learner permit, or non-driver identification card and Social Security card or Social Security Administration printout (reflecting your name change) along with one of the following original documents: Certified marriage certificate (name change due to marriage)
There is no time limit on changing your name. Many states would like you to inform them of your name change within 30 days of your marriage, but will allow you to change your name after that.
Name Change In order to change your name on your DMV record(s) and document(s), you must visit a DMV customer service center and bring with you: A completed “Driver's License and Identification Card Application” (DL-1P) requesting a change of name, or start online.
After your request is approved and signed by the judge, there's no escaping one of the worst experiences known to man a trip to the DMV. It will cost you $27 to change the name on your driver's license and $29 for your state I.D. Meanwhile, updating your Social Security Card is free.
Change your name at the SSA by following the steps detailed above. Fill out the appropriate DMV forms. Provide legal evidence supporting your name change. Pay an application fee. Surrender the driver's license with your former name.
To change your name on your license or learner permit, you will need to provide evidence of your name change, for example, a civil marriage certificate/deed poll in addition to the documentation required to confirm your ID.
